python - Generate a heatmap in MatPlotLib using a scatter data …
Jun 21, 2011 · Convert your time series data into a numeric format with matplotlib.dats.date2num. Lay down a rectangular grid that spans your x and y ranges and do your convolution on that plot. Make a pseudo-color plot of your convolution and then reformat the x labels to be dates. The label formatting is a little messy, but reasonably well documented.
